I'd like to coin my own cookie-cutter response for whenever people say "God wants this" or "you must do that" or "there's no doubt in my mind that God wouldn't...". Here it is:

"Do you have any objective evidence to back up this absolute claim? (Please don't appeal to your holy book, because the other holy books also make the same claims)"

Feel free to c/p it and use it whenever necessary. Just be sure to add a trademark at the end.
